The original of this painting is an old dutch flower still life from the 17th century. I began to disassemble the picture, to show them only in individual snippets that, seemingly dancing, vaguely quote the original. In a book I stumbled over a sentence given by a young admirer to his much older loved one: "Never stop blooming" (ChirĂº - Michela Murgia). It perfectly describes my feeling for the aim to transport the old still life into the contemporary.
